La Capranera, Fiano (2022)

La Capranera, Fiano (2022)

 REGION: Campania

COUNTRY: Italy

GRAPE(S): Fiano

BODY: Light

ABV: 13%

TASTING NOTES: Crisp, green apple and crushed stone notes on the nose. Orchard fruits on the palate with a saline minerality on the finish.

WINEMAKING NOTES: The grapes are softly crushed and fermented in temperature-controlled stainless-steel tanks. The wine ages for eight months in tank before bottling. Sustainable. 

FUN FACT: La Capranera, which translates to "black goat" in Italian, is named for the breed of goats - cilentana nera - that graze in the national park near where the grapes are grown. Once on the verge of becoming extinct, the goats have had a resurgence in population, just as wines from Campania have recently enjoyed increased visibility internationally.

PAIRS WELL WITH: Caprese salads and grilled poultry.
